The global dural graft market is witnessing steady growth, driven by increasing demand for safe and effective neurosurgical solutions. Dural grafts are medical devices used to repair or replace damaged dura mater, the protective membrane surrounding the brain and spinal cord. They are essential in treating traumatic brain injuries (TBI), spinal injuries, and other neurological disorders where duraplasty is required. Market Segmentation
The dural graft market can be segmented primarily by product type and application. By product type, the market is divided into autologous, allogeneic, xenogeneic, and synthetic grafts. Among these, xenogeneic grafts currently dominate, as they offer excellent biocompatibility and surgical handling, with a proven success rate of 96.9% in duraplasty procedures. Synthetic grafts are gaining traction, particularly due to innovations targeting reduced cerebrospinal fluid (CSF) leakage and better integration with minimally invasive surgical tools.
By application, the market is largely driven by traumatic brain and spine injury surgeries, which accounted for approximately 51.4% of the total market in 2025. The growing geriatric population, combined with the rising prevalence of road traffic accidents and sports-related injuries, has increased the demand for neurosurgical procedures requiring dural repair. Other applications include tumor resections, spinal cord injuries, and cranial defect repairs, all of which require reliable dural closure to prevent complications such as CSF leakage, infections, and pseudomeningocele formation.

Market Restraints
Despite steady growth, the dural graft market faces challenges related to the shortage of skilled neurosurgeons, particularly in low- and middle-income countries. Globally, there are approximately 49,940 neurosurgeons, with uneven distribution: the median density is just 3.56 neurosurgeons per million people, while 33 countries have no practicing neurosurgeons. In regions like Africa, the ratio may be as low as 0.11 neurosurgeons per 100,000 population.
This workforce shortage significantly limits the adoption of dural graft technologies, especially in emerging markets where access to neurosurgical care is already constrained. As a result, even with high demand for dural repair procedures, market expansion can be restricted until training and workforce development programs address these gaps.
